The Impact of Anemia on One-Year Amputation-Free Survival in Patients Undergoing Revascularization for Chronic Limb-Threatening Ischemia: A Retrospective Cohort Study

Autor: Theuma, Francesca, Nickinson, Andrew T.O., Cullen, Sarah, Patel, Bhavisha, Dubkova, Svetlana, Davies, Robert S.M., Sayers, Rob D.
Zdroj: Annals of Vascular Surgery; February 2022, Vol. 79 Issue: 1 p201-207, 7p
Abstrakt: Anemia is potentially associated with increased morbidity and mortality following vascular surgery procedures. This study investigated whether peri-procedural anemia is associated with reduced 1-year amputation-free survival (AFS) in patients undergoing revascularization for chronic limb-threatening ischemia (CLTI).
